Lan Qi Technology released the fifth generation Jinnao CPU: supports up to 48 cores and 96 threads

CTOnews.com December 18 news, Lanqi Technology released a new fifth-generation Tianjin CPU, based on Intel fifth-generation Xeon Scalable Processor Core (code name: Emerald Rapids), is an x86 architecture server processor for the local market.
CTOnews.com learned from Lanqi Technology that a single CPU supports up to 48 cores, 96 threads, and a maximum L3 cache capacity of 260MB; supports DDR5 memory speeds up to 5600MT/s, and UPI speeds between CPUs up to 20GT/s; based on LINPACK tests, its comprehensive floating point computing performance is up to 40%(compared to the fourth generation).
The fifth generation CPU has a built-in AI acceleration engine, lower standby power consumption and higher energy efficiency ratio, which can effectively reduce the TCO of the data center.
At present, a number of server manufacturers have cooperated with Lanqi Technology, and models equipped with partners of the fifth generation of Tianjin CPU have been listed for six times.
